The Tricky Parts
The truth is, every style comes with a little downside.
If you’re playful, people might not know you’re serious.
If you lean mysterious, someone could walk away unsure if you even care.
Being bold is amazing, but sometimes it’s a lot for people who aren’t on the same wavelength.
And the heartfelt style? Beautiful, but it can feel intense too quickly.
None of this makes flirting bad — it’s actually what keeps it interesting.
The fun part is noticing your habits and figuring out if they match what you really want.
Sometimes the smallest shift, like being a little more direct or a little more playful, totally changes the vibe.
